The current Tuscany Webapp support that we have in 1.x is described on the wiki page at [1], I'd like to start bringing this up in the 2.x code base so we need to decide what we want to support. Right now i'm focusing on similar support as we have in 1.x where the webapp is a container for a Tuscany runtime and not so much on the webapp as an SCA contribution which requires deep integration into the servlet container (which we're working on separately with the Tuscany-Geronimo plugin work).
So in 1.x we support three ways of defining the composites included in the webapp: - using a META-INF/sca-contributions.xml - by including deployable composite files within a folder named META-INF/sca-deployables - by using an WEB-INF/web.composite application composite How about dropping those first two and only supporting web.composite in 2.x? ...ant [1] http://cwiki.apache.org/confluence/display/TUSCANY/SCA+Java+Web+Applications
